To: Dispatch Desk. Re: museum labels, Thornvale Gallery opening. Crate of printed labels for the new east wing is packed and sitting in bay 2, marked fragile. Curator needs them on-site by Thursday or install slips. Do not stack anything on top — the mounts bend. Single crate, one manifest, no substitutions. Courier from Redgate Express booked for tomorrow 09:15. Confirm collection back to me same day. The confidential hand-over instruction for the courier is set out directly below this message.

handover note for yagef-bagep: the drudor pelius courier leaves the kasdor zorvan norir ledger at gate 8016 under passcode 755406

Subject: AgriLink Gateway 4.2 rollout tonight

Team,

The AgriLink telemetry gateway build for the Harvestor fleet goes live at 02:00. Please watch the ingest dashboards for the first hour; the new CAN-bus parser changes how soil-moisture frames are batched, so brief queue spikes are expected. If ingestion stalls past ten minutes, roll back immediately. The exact build token to reference when paging Marenda is below.

session token of bajog-tadup = htk3_ffc

- [ ] Verify the Gaugewick metrics sidecar ships with the new flush interval (15s) and that counter rollups match the primary emitter under load. Run the soak harness for ten minutes; deltas over 0.5% block release. Confirm memory cap holds at 64MB. The sidecar build used for sign-off is recorded below.

session token of yahof-bajeg = htk9_0d43d44ed